    Briefly, classical probability applies to cases where there are a finite number of possible outcomes, each equally likely, like flipping a coin or rolling a die. Relative frequencies are those cases in which there are many trials, and we count how often a particular outcome occurs. Clearly, neither of these work in the case of horse racing.

    horse 7’s advantage increases considerably for longer tracks (Table 1, Figure 1). For the track length of 10 used in the lesson, the probability that horse 7 will win is about 0.42, which is much greater than 1 6. Table 1.
